Private Wealth Partner
London
£250,000+
Lead Private Wealth Partner opportunity with this very well liked and progressive City firm.
Our client has a strong reputation for private wealth work, advising HNW clients with UK and international assets on succession planning, asset protection, tax trusts and estates work.
There is a super platform at this firm for an experienced private wealth partner looking to be part of a forward thinking, merit based operation. You\’ll have a strong network, proven client care and leadership skills and you\’ll bring a commercial, considered approach.
Home to an established client portfolio, sizeable national team and a flexible and inclusive culture, you\’ll have the remit to help shape the next phase of growth, working closely with a supportive team of expert individuals.
